linux版Multibit中文字体显示为方框的问题

时间:2013年10月12日 18:43 星期六 栏目:未分类 作者: 评论:0 点击: 1,425 次

说来羞射,上回装了个linux版Multibit,在树莓派上可以正常显示中文菜单,在debian系统上中文部分就显示为主框。由于Multibit是基于Java运行的,像这样中文显示为方框(不是乱码)是字体设置出了问题,这是共识,网上也有许多针对不同Java版本解决问题的资料,不过年代都有点老,都解决不了我现成的问题,因为我找不到那些Java环境的目录和文件。树莓派上的系统就是基于debian的,肯定是哪里设置不对。百试不得骑姐,就凑合用着英文版,反正就那么几个fuck do。

今天突然想到一点:会不会是字体没选中的问题呢?赶紧试一下,GogSun的还真是。如果把界面设置为中文就全是方框,如果把界面设置为英文,然后选择修改为其它字体的时候,最后面几个字体名也是方框,我知道那是中文名字体,但没想到就应该选这个。随便选一个方框字体之后生效,界面就全变中文了。羞死人了。

在这个环境中,不像Windows一样,设置为中文布局之后,碰上显示不出字体的中文会以默认的中文字体(如宋体)来显示,在Linux的Java环境里没有默认的中文字体,所以就显示方框,我却以为是Java的环境设置没弄好,在这邪路上走了很久。

结论:我们不能在邪路上越走越远。

相关文章

linux版Multibit中文字体显示为方框的问题:等您坐沙发呢!

发表评论

您必须 [ 登录 ] 才能发表留言!

Baidu提供的广告

最近访客

    最新评论